How to Use WordPress to Create a Real Estate Website Here’s Where You’ll Find the Best Methods!

Creating a real estate website can seem daunting, but it can be an easy and efficient process with the right tools and knowledge. WordPress is one of the most popular website-building platforms, and it’s no surprise why. WordPress is user-friendly, flexible, and allows for customization. In this article, we’ll explore the best methods for using WordPress to create a real estate website that stands out.

Choose the Right WordPress Theme

One of the first things you need to consider when creating a real estate website using WordPress is the theme you’ll use. A theme is a collection of files that dictate how your website looks and functions. Plenty of WordPress themes are available, but not all are ideal for a real estate website. You want to choose a theme that’s easy to navigate, visually appealing, and optimized for speed.

Some popular themes for real estate websites are Houzez, Real Homes, and WP Pro Real Estate 7. These themes come with built-in features such as property search options, property galleries, and virtual tours.

Use a Real Estate Plugin

WordPress plugins are add-ons that can extend the functionality of your website. Many plugins are available for WordPress, but for a real estate website, you’ll want to use a plugin specifically designed for the real estate industry.

Real estate plugins can help you create property listings, manage property details, and provide a user-friendly experience for your visitors. Some popular real estate plugins for WordPress are WP-Property, Easy Property Listings, and Estatik.

Optimize Your Website for Search Engines

Search engine optimization (SEO) is optimizing your website to rank higher in search engine results pages (SERPs). SEO is essential for any website but especially important for a real estate website. You want your website to appear in search results when people search for properties in your area.

To optimize your website for search engines, you’ll need to:

  • Use descriptive page titles and meta descriptions
  • Use keywords in your content and URLs
  • Optimize images with alt tags and descriptive file names
  • Use internal linking to help search engines understand the structure of your website

Showcase Your Properties with High-Quality Images

One of the essential elements of a real estate website is the images of the properties. Your website visitors will want to see what the properties look like before they decide to contact you for more information.

Make sure you use high-quality images that showcase the property in the best light possible. You can hire a professional photographer or take the photos yourself if you have the skills and equipment.

Provide Detailed Property Information

Your website visitors will want to know as much as possible about your listed properties. Ensure you provide detailed property information, such as the number of bedrooms and bathrooms, square footage, and unique features.

You should also provide information about the neighborhood, including schools, amenities, and transportation options. The more information you provide, the more likely visitors are to contact you for more information.

Make Your Website Mobile-Friendly

More and more people are using their mobile devices to browse the internet. Your real estate website must be mobile-friendly, meaning it can be easily viewed on various devices, including smartphones and tablets.

WordPress themes are usually responsive, meaning they adjust their layout based on the screen size. However, testing your website on different devices is essential to ensure it looks and functions correctly.

Include Calls to Action

A call to action (CTA) is a button or link that encourages website visitors to take a specific action, such as contacting you for more information. CTAs are essential for converting website visitors into leads.

Ensure you include CTAs throughout your website, including on property listings, about pages, and contact pages. Use clear and compelling language, such as “Contact us today to schedule a viewing” or “Learn more about this property by contacting us now.”

Provide Virtual Tours

Virtual tours give website visitors a better sense of a property without physically visiting it. There are several ways to provide virtual tours, including 3D tours, video tours, and photo slideshows.

You can create virtual tours using tools like Matterport, TourWizard, or Zillow 3D Home. Ensure you include virtual tours on your property listings to provide a more immersive experience for your website visitors.

Integrate Social Media

Social media is essential for promoting your real estate business and engaging with potential clients. Ensure you integrate social media into your website by including social media icons that link to your profiles.

You can also include social media feeds on your website to showcase your latest posts and activities. This can help build trust with potential clients and make it easier for them to connect with you on social media.

Provide Resources for Buyers and Sellers

Finally, you can provide resources for buyers and sellers on your real estate website. This can include home buying and selling guides, market reports, and neighborhood profiles.

By providing valuable resources, you position yourself as an authority in the real estate industry and provide more value to your website visitors. This can also help generate leads and build your reputation as a trusted real estate agent.


Creating a real estate website using WordPress is a great way to showcase your properties and attract potential clients. By choosing the suitable theme, using real estate plugins, optimizing for search engines, showcasing your properties with high-quality images and virtual tours, making your website mobile-friendly, including calls to action, integrating social media, and providing resources for buyers and sellers, you can create a website that stands out and generates leads for your real estate business.



Scroll to Top